How much do freelance e&m medical coder j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for freelance e&m medical coder in the United States is $22.42,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.03 and $24.04 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Can I do medical coding as a side hustle?

Freelance E&M Medical Coders can often work as a side hustle, as medical coding is typically project-based and allows flexible scheduling. However, they need to ensure they meet certification requirements, have access to coding tools, and manage their workload to comply with client deadlines and maintain accuracy.

Will AI eventually replace medical coders?

As a freelance E&M medical coder, AI is expected to assist rather than replace the role, automating routine coding tasks and improving accuracy. Human oversight remains essential for complex cases, compliance, and interpretation of medical documentation. Coding professionals will need to adapt by developing skills in AI tools and maintaining certification standards.

Can you freelance medical billing and coding?

Freelance E&M Medical Coders can work independently by providing coding services to healthcare providers, often remotely. They typically need certification, such as CPC or CCS, and familiarity with coding software and guidelines. Freelancers set their own schedules and rates but must ensure compliance with industry standards and payer requirements.

What type of medical coder gets paid the most?

In medical coding, specialized roles such as inpatient hospital coders, often requiring advanced certifications like CCS or CPC-H, tend to earn higher salaries. Experienced coders with expertise in complex areas like radiology, cardiology, or oncology also typically receive higher pay. Freelance E&M Medical Coders with strong skills and certifications can command higher rates, especially when handling complex or high-volume cases.

What is the difference between Freelance E&M Medical Coder vs In-House E&M Medical Coder?

AspectFreelance E&M Medical CoderIn-House E&M Medical Coder
CertificationsTypically CPC, CCS, or equivalentSame certifications as freelance
Work EnvironmentRemote, independent contractorOn-site or remote within healthcare facility
EmployerSelf-employed or contracted through agenciesHealthcare provider or hospital
Work FlexibilityHigh, set own hoursStandard hours, fixed schedule

Freelance E&M Medical Coders work independently, often remotely, with flexible hours and contract-based arrangements. In contrast, In-House E&M Medical Coders are employed directly by healthcare facilities, working on-site or remotely with fixed schedules. Both roles require similar certifications and knowledge of E&M coding, but differ mainly in work setting and employment structure.
